Helmet
- A Deathwatch style “Nite Owl” helmet must be used.
- The main color of the helmet is medium to dark grey with the cheeks and mandibles and painted white ans light grey to match visual references.
- A distressed ligjt grey or white “V” logo is located at the center of the forehead.
- The rangefinder is colored a medium to dark grey with ear-cap and stalk the located on the right side of the helmet.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Shoulder Armor
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ick and be of the Death Watch Nite Owl style.
- Must have four points and must curve around the upper arm.
- Both shoulders include a “Nite Owl” logo in the center of each piece.
- Must be painted medium to dark grey and weathered to match references.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Chest Armor
- Consists of collar armor, right and left chest plates, abdominal plate, and center diamond.
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the Death Watch Nite Owl style.
- The Collar, Abdominal and Chest plates must be painted medium to dark gr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- Center diamond has a raised vertical rectangle and should match visual references.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Back Armor
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the animated Death Watch style.
- Must be painted medium to dark gr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Cod Armor
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the Death Watch Nite Owl style.
- The Cod armor is medium to dark grey and made of three segmented pieces.
- Codpiece is worn below all of the belts, and should be sized to the wearer.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Thigh Armor
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the Death Watch Night Owl style.
- Must be painted medium to dark gr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- The plates have built in holsters for a Westar 35 blaster.
- The plates have no visible attachment method.
- A grey strap is located at the mid-upper portion of the armor that securely fastens around the upper thigh.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Knee Armor
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the Death Watch Nite Owl style.
- Must be painted goldish brown and weathered to match reference photos.
- The plates have no visible strapping or attachment method.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Shin Armor
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the Death Watch Night Owl style.
- Must be painted light gr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- The plates have no visible strapping or attachment method.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Boots
- Ankle high, black or dark grey with a rubber sole.
- Boot armor must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the animated Death Watch Nite Owl style.
- Consists of Ankle spats, Toe caps and Heel covers with raised rectangular horizontal sections.
- Must be painted light gr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- Heel cover is painted black with a rectangular horizontal light grey section in the middle of the rear.
- Toe cap and heal cover are attached with no visible means of attachment.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Gloves
- The gloves are made of sturdy materials such as leather, leather-like material, or tight fitting canvas and are dark blue in color. Should match the flightsuit color as closely as possible. No rubber gloves are permitted.
- Gloves are tucked underneath the gauntlets to match references.
Left Gauntlet
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the Death Watch style.
- Must be painted white or light gr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- Left gauntlet contains the following components:
- Gauntlet buttons should match visual references as closely as possible.
- Features four forward facing darts in front of middle section.
- Contains a silver grappling hook to match references in style and placement.
- Contains a slot for the hidden knife to extend or retract. Placement must match visual references.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Right Gauntlet
- Must appear to be at least 3mm thick in the animated Death Watch style.
- The gauntlet has a raised front section with the closure worn on the inside.
- Right gauntlet contains the following components:
- Gauntlet buttons should match visual references as closely as possible.
- A slit for blade disc to be expelled over wrist opening to match visual references.
- Red colored, trapezoid-shaped range finder target.
- Two forward facing grey or silver blasters, in front of middle section.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Flight Suit
- Made of a cotton or cotton spandex lycra blend material, one or two-piece garment and must be fitted snug to the wearers body.
- The flightsuit must be dark blue in color and fit appropriately to match visual references.
Neck Seal
- The Neck Seal should match references and can be a turtleneck style attached to the flightsuit or attached to the vest. Should be made out of similar material as the flightsuit.
- Must be dark grey weathered to match reference photos.
- If a neck seal closure is present, an attempt to conceal it should be made.
Flak Vest
- The flak vest is dark grey, made out of similar material as the flight suit and should match references as closely possible.
- The short sleeves extend slightly past the shoulder armor
- The vest must be long enough to extend under the girth belt.
- The short sleeves should be trimmed around the bottom in grey to match visual references.
Ammo Belt
- The ammo belt is dark brown and made of a leather or leather-like material and match references in width. Width should be appropriately scaled to the height of the wearer.
- The ammo belt has no apparent closure method. Recommended closure method would be hidden Velcro in the back.
- Attached to the belt are eight equally sized Ammo Boxes.
Girth Belt
- The girth belt is dark brown and made of a thick leather, or leather-like material and match references in width. Width should be appropriately scaled to the height of the wearer.
- Belt featurings horizontal lines to match visual references.
- The girth belt closure should attach in the back and match visual references with the closure method hidden if possible
Jetpack
- Animated Nite Owl style jetpack.
- Must be painted medium to dark grey & white or light gr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- Jetpack must fit snugly against and centered on the back plate.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
Weapon
- Dual Westar-35 blaster pistols.
- Must be painted medium to dark grey and weathered to match reference photos.
- Paints should have a dull satin or matte finish appearance to match visual references as closely as possible.
